Join our dedicated team as a Certified Nursing Assistant (C.N.A.) and make a meaningful difference in the lives of our residents! This role is central to providing high-quality nursing care and support to residents, ensuring their comfort, dignity, and well-being. The ideal candidate will: Deliver compassionate nursing care to residents while honoring their rights, dignity, and individuality. Show respect and attentiveness to the diverse backgrounds of our residents, families, and caregivers. Understand and implement individualized care plans to support residents effectively. Engage in the Quality Assurance and Performance Improvement (QAPI) process to enhance care practices. Assist residents with daily personal care tasks, including bathroom assistance, hygiene, dressing, mobility, and nutrition. Maintain confidentiality and respect resident rights at all times. Document daily activities and care provided in the electronic health record accurately. Observe and promptly report any changes in residents' conditions to nursing staff. Assist in repositioning residents as required to promote comfort and health. Proactively report any incidents or potential violations of resident rights to nursing supervisors. Honor residents' right to decline care and communicate such decisions to nursing staff. Help maintain a clean, safe, and supportive environment for all residents. Respond promptly and courteously to resident call bells and check on those unable to call for help. Document vital signs, intake/output, and weight measurements accurately in the electronic health record. Assist residents with mobility and transfers using proper techniques and equipment. Utilize designated equipment safely and report any defects immediately to supervisors. Communicate effectively and compassionately with residents, families, and team members.
